Technical Analysis

Immediate key support for CMIIW sits at $0.31, a price floor tested multiple times in trading activity earlier this month, with small pockets of dip-buying interest emerging near this level during recent sessions. The immediate resistance level for the warrant is $0.35, a price point that CMIIW has failed to break above in four separate tests over the course of this month, with sellers consistently stepping in to cap upward momentum near this threshold. The relative strength index (RSI) for CMIIW is currently in the mid-30s, a range that many technical traders associate with oversold conditions, though this indicator alone does not signal an imminent price reversal. Shorter-term moving averages for the asset are currently trading above the current spot price, confirming recent downward momentum, while longer-term moving averages are also sloping lower, consistent with the sustained downtrend seen in recent weeks. Trading volume during the recent pullback has been dominated by sell orders, though small inflows near the $0.31 support level suggest some market participants are entering positions at current price points. Outlook

If CMIIW manages to hold above the $0.31 support level in upcoming sessions, the asset could potentially retest the $0.35 resistance level, particularly if broader risk sentiment for SPAC-related assets improves in the near term. A sustained break above the $0.35 resistance level would likely open the door for a move toward higher price levels last seen earlier this month, though trading volume would likely need to rise above current levels to support a sustained upward move. On the downside, a break below the $0.31 support level could lead to further price weakness, as technical traders who entered positions near that floor may exit their holdings, potentially adding to selling pressure. Market participants are also monitoring for any potential updates from Columbus Circle Capital Corp II related to its business combination search, which could act as a fundamental catalyst for outsized price moves outside of the identified technical levels in either direction. Analysts caution that SPAC warrants carry high inherent volatility, so risk management protocols are particularly important for market participants considering exposure to the asset class.
